Our Approach

1. Organizational Assessment
- Establish owner expectations and goals
- Gain a big picture view while understanding any challenges
- Observe and develop an approach to meet the owner’s goals
2. Strategic Analysis
- Perform a resource-based analysis
- Determine critical success factors
- Develop a strategic map making the leadership team’s plan easy to comprehend company-wide
- Analyze business economics and evaluate growth potential
3. Operational Refinement
- Provide an array of options which align with objectives
- Propose changes to optimize operations and leverage resources
- Develop financial projections and identify funding alternatives
4. Execute
- Implement process improvements and system enhancements
- Build management talent to enhance growth capacity
- Design and institute performance tracking metrics

Kathy Willis
Kathy Willis has practiced in both public and private accounting. She has more than 30 years of experience as Chief Financial Officer where she was leading all the financial and accounting management activities. She also served in a senior management role as an essential member of the Executive Committee and an advisor to the Board of Directors. In addition to financial reporting and analysis, Kathy has a strong background in the areas of budgeting, business and operational planning, warehouse and inventory management, treasury management, debt financing and restructuring, mergers and acquisitions and other functional areas that include human resources and IT management.
Kathy’s qualifications also include developing and implementing financial controls and processes, in addition to productivity improvements and change management. She possesses solid le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ills to establish rapport with all levels of staff and management.
Kathy is a graduate of Lenoir-Rhyne college with a Bachelor of Science degree in Accounting. She completed a four week management course through the America Management Association. Kathy also served two terms on the Board of Director’s for the National Association of Hosiery Management.

Elizabeth Abbas
Elizabeth brings over 20 years of experience as a successful real estate agent, which has provided her with a strong foundation in entrepreneurship, financial operations, and cash flow management. Her background gives her a practical, business-owner perspective and a deep understanding of the operational challenges faced by growing companies. She is known for her ability to build structure, improve workflows, and support teams in delivering consistent and effective service.
Elizabeth is a graduate of Florida State University with a degree in Finance. After more than two decades in real estate, she transitioned to Nexagy to achieve a better work–family balance while continuing to apply her financial and operational expertise. Elizabeth enjoys helping entrepreneurs better understand the numbers behind their business and is passionate about creating strong operational foundations that support long-term success.
